The court fined Sergei Tsukasov, an unregistered candidate for the Moscow City Duma, 170 thousand rubles for a picket on Trubnaya
The Dorogomilovsky District Court of Moscow fined Sergei Tsukasov, a municipal deputy of the Ostankinsky district and an unregistered candidate for the Moscow City Duma, 170,000 rubles. He wrote about it on Facebook. He was found guilty of repeated violation of the rules for holding a public event (part 8 of article 20.2 of the Code of Administrative Offenses) for picketing on August 3 at Trubnaya Square.

The court fined a US citizen detained after the rally on August 10
The Khoroshevsky District Court of Moscow has fined U.S. citizen Tatyana Brennik, who was detained in the center of Moscow on August 10, 10,000 rubles, reports Dozhd . She was found guilty of violating the established procedure for holding a rally (part 5 of article 20.2 of the Code of Administrative Offenses). Brennick, in an interview with Radio Liberty , said that she has two citizenships - Russian and American, but lives and works in Russia as a lawyer.

In Moscow, the head of the district tax inspectorate was arrested for bribery
The Presnensky Court of Moscow arrested until October 21 the head of the district tax inspectorate No. 24, Maria Andreyanova. It is reported by TASS. “The Presnensky District Court of Moscow chose a measure of restraint in the form of detention <…> for a period of 1 month 29 days, i.e. until October 21, 2019,” the court said. She is accused of taking a bribe on an especially large scale (Part 6, Article 290 of the Criminal Code).

Norwegian seismologists: On August 8, two explosions occurred at the Nenoksa test site
Norwegian seismologists claim that on August 8 there were two explosions at the Nenoksa test site. Such data were recorded by the sensors of the Norwegian independent agency for monitoring seismic phenomena (NORSAR), reports Reuters. According to the agency, 2 hours passed between the two explosions, the second of which coincided with a sharp increase in the radiation background.

A court in Yekaterinburg has placed a second police officer under arrest in connection with the rape of a woman.
The Leninsky District Court of Yekaterinburg has taken into custody until October 19 police officer Vyacheslav Tropin, whom the Investigative Committee suspects of participating in the rape of a 22-year-old citizen of Kazakhstan. This is reported by the portal E1. Earlier, the court also sent Tropin's colleague Andrei Bessarabov to a pre-trial detention center for two months, and a third police officer, Vadim Mustafin, was placed under house arrest.

Rospotrebnadzor refused to check the Moscow City Election Commission for the presence of bedbugs. A member of the commission spoke about parasites in the building when Sobol was being carried out on a sofa.
Rospotrebnadzor refused to conduct an inspection of the Moscow City Election Commission at the request of Pavel Chikov, head of the Agora human rights group. He asked to check the building after the sofa standing in the Moscow City Electoral Committee, on which the unregistered candidate for deputies Lyubov Sobol was sitting, was taken out to shake out parasites and bedbugs. Rospotrebnadzor noted that Chikov's appeal does not contain the information necessary for an unscheduled inspection.

In the Chelyabinsk region, the ex-deputy head of the police department was arrested in a rape case
The Chebarkul city court arrested for two months the former deputy head of the police department, Rif Biktimirov, in the case of rape and harassment of subordinates. It is reported by 74.ru. He is accused of harassing five subordinates (Part 1 of Article 133 of the Criminal Code) and of rape (Article 131 of the Criminal Code). The meeting was held behind closed doors.

Three employees of the St. Petersburg pre-trial detention center “Kresty-2” were fired after complaints of torture
Three employees of the Kresty-2 pre-trial detention center in St. Petersburg were fired after checking complaints of torture. This was reported to TASS by the press bureau of the Federal Penitentiary Service. Another 20 employees and heads of the detention center and the regional department of the Federal Penitentiary Service were brought to disciplinary responsibility. The audit materials were sent to the investigating authorities “for decision-making”.

The leader of the Circassian organization "Khabze" Martin Kochesoko was released from house arrest
The Supreme Court of Kabardino-Balkaria released from house arrest the head of the Circassian organization "Khabze" Martin Kochesoko, who was previously accused of purchasing and possessing drugs (Part 2 of Article 228 of the Criminal Code). to MBKh Media This was reported by his lawyer Timur Khutov. According to him, they will no longer conduct investigative actions in the Kochesoko case, and the state prosecutor had no arguments to extend the house arrest.

Google has removed more than 200 YouTube channels due to videos about Hong Kong protests
Google has removed 210 YouTube channels that posted videos related to the Hong Kong protests. This was reported on the company's website. "We disabled 210 YouTube channels when we discovered they were uploading videos related to the Hong Kong protests in a coordinated manner," Google said in a statement. According to the company, the creators of blocked accounts used VPN services and other methods to hide their location. This week, Twitter suspended 936 accounts originating from China.

Dmitry Gudkov was given another 10 days of arrest. Now - for the promotion on July 27
The Koptevsky District Court of Moscow has arrested politician Dmitry Gudkov for 10 days for a rally in support of independent candidates on July 27 in central Moscow, the politician's press secretary Alexei Obukhov told Novaya Gazeta. According to the prosecution, Gudkov, having published a collective statement of unregistered candidates on his social networks, urged citizens to go to an unauthorized rally.
